The relationship between media and society remains a hot-spot issue in journalism and communication research. Such elements as politics, economic and cultural, play a key role on the springing, flourishing and development of media. And the political system, economy and culture motion, are also profoundly effected by the media. Nowadays, China is processing a transforming era, culture—especially the popular culture is reflecting the features of the transforming society, just like a mirror. Meanwhile, as popular culture relies on the technology, such achievement of media's reflection is reached by the means of popular media on the root, and at the same time, popular culture is coined with the features of the popular media, or in some researchers' word—"mediumlization". The essay makes an analysis on the media's influences on the popular culture, and the causes of "mediumlization" and its effect on both advantages and disadvantages, trying to dig out the inner relationship between mass media and popular culture. In the essay, plenty of advice on the construct of cultural system and advanced culture are listed and analyzed.
